As mentioned, a centrally located apartment in the heart of Kyoto. Close enough to walk to the main shopping district, whilst being in a peaceful and quiet neighbourhood with plenty of food options late into the night. The apartment is well kept and cosy! I have stayed in bigger apartments in HK that feel more cramped! Narita is extremely helpful with their tips/post-its, and it was a pity i did not get to meet her. I would definitely stay with them again the next time I return to Kyoto. Thanks for the awesome experience guys!
